Picked up one of these:
AG-126 Lithium Ion Battery Charger
For my Chuck.
Issue is that the charger itself doesn't have positive and negative polarity points.
If I put the brand new batteries in one way it shows green, flip them around and it shows red.
I don't want to burn these guys out by over charging them. So what do I do to figure out which is which?
I'm still waiting on my Chuck to go through the batteries by the way - I guess the ultimate solution is to wait for the Chuck and use a battery up, then whichever way turns red is the proper polarity for the battery to charge?
